In addition to Weibo, there is also WeChat
Please pay attention
WeChat public account
Shulou
2025-02-28 Update From: SLTechnology News&Howtos shulou NAV: SLTechnology News&Howtos > Database >
Share
Shulou(Shulou.com)06/01 Report--
This article mainly introduces the difference between database mirroring and replication, the article is very detailed, has a certain reference value, interested friends must read it!
What is database mirroring?
Database mirroring is a technique for creating and maintaining redundant copies of a database, which are always synchronized with the principal database; these database copies are usually located on different machines. This technology helps ensure uninterrupted data availability and reduces downtime due to data corruption or loss.
It can create copies of the database in two different server instances (principal and mirror). These mirrored replicas work as alternate copies and are not always active like data replication.
In the event of any failure, it can recover data by copying data from one database to another. In the event of any failover, the mirror database becomes the primary database.
What is database replication?
Database replication is the technique of copying data and distributing these copies from one database to another.
In replication, data and database objects are replicated and distributed from one database to another. It reduces the load on the original database server because the client can use multiple servers; and all servers that replicate the database are as active as the primary server. To maintain consistency between data and database objects, the database is also synchronized.
This technique can be used to replicate data in multiple databases. Partial replication is implemented only for a subset of a table or a column of a row, so it basically cannot replicate the entire database.
Key differences between replication and mirroring:
1. A mirror database can usually be found on a different machine from its master database. Instead, the replicated data and database objects are stored in another database.
2. Mirroring does not support distributed environment, but replication is designed for distributed database.
3. The cost of database mirroring is higher than replication.
Replication and mirroring technologies can also be combined to achieve higher database availability.
These are all the contents of the article "what's the difference between database mirroring and replication". Thank you for reading! Hope to share the content to help you, more related knowledge, welcome to follow the industry information channel!
Welcome to subscribe "Shulou Technology Information " to get latest news, interesting things and hot topics in the IT industry, and controls the hottest and latest Internet news, technology news and IT industry trends.
Views: 0
*The comments in the above article only represent the author's personal views and do not represent the views and positions of this website. If you have more insights, please feel free to contribute and share.
Continue with the installation of the previous hadoop.First, install zookooper1. Decompress zookoope
"Every 5-10 years, there's a rare product, a really special, very unusual product that's the most un
© 2024 shulou.com SLNews company. All rights reserved.